Senior Minor Home Repair Program

 

Flint NIPP is now offering minor home repair services to low to moderate income citizens of Flint age 60 years and older who own and occupy their homes.  Flint NIPP's Senior Minor Home Repair Program is available to seniors citywide who meet the HUD Section 8 income guidelines, and is intended to aid seniors who are unable to make repairs themselves due to age, illness and frailty.  This program will provide preventive and corrective improvements to homes to remedy a substandard condition or safety hazard by providing qualified individuals to complete minor home repairs.  All labor is provided free of cost.  Services rendered will provide a permanent restoration to extend the life of the home.  Repairs will include but not limited to:

  • Light carpentry

  • Plumbing

  • Light electrical

  • Door & window repair

  • Lock installation & repair

  • Gutter/eaves/downspouts maintenance & repair

If repairs needed require a Building Permit form the City of Flint, they are not eligible under this program.  If you or anyone you know is a low-income homeowner 60 years or older and in need of minor home repairs, please call our office.
